Medical Innovation Holdings, Inc. (OTC: MIHI) this morning announced an acceleration of deploying a national telemedicine infrastructure with virtual addiction specialists to work with the thousands of Americans addicted to pain killers, particularly in rural and remote areas of the country. This announcement comes in the wake of President Trump declaring the opioid crisis a National Public Health Emergency, effectively giving federal health officials the ability to circumvent many existing policies regarding public health and allowing a national network to exist. “Under the act Dr. Don Wright, Secretary of Health and Human Services, will be able to modify the practice of telemedicine,” Jake Sanchez, CEO of Medical Innovation Holdings, explained in the news release. “In other words, using telemedicine to treat addiction and prescribe medication for Medicare, Medicaid, and Children’s Health and Insurance Program, known as CHIPS. We are uniquely positioned to answer this call to duty.”
